Cinebench 10 32-bit single-core

Cinebench R10 is an ancient ray tracing benchmark for processors by Maxon, authors of Cinema 4D. Its single core version uses just one CPU thread to render a futuristic looking motorcycle.

Benchmark coverage: 20%

Turion 64 X2 TL-52 1324
Celeron M 540 1744
+31.7%

Celeron M 540 outperforms Turion 64 X2 TL-52 by 32% in Cinebench 10 32-bit single-core.

3DMark06 CPU

3DMark06 is a discontinued DirectX 9 benchmark suite from Futuremark. Its CPU part contains two scenarios, one dedicated to artificial intelligence pathfinding, another to game physics using PhysX package.

Benchmark coverage: 19%

Turion 64 X2 TL-52 1205
+50.2%
Celeron M 540 803

Turion 64 X2 TL-52 outperforms Celeron M 540 by 50% in 3DMark06 CPU.
